How to fix the save problem bug of F1 2012
A very common problem with F1 2012 is that the save option stop working randomly, and get stuck. All career progress, settings, statistics, etc... all is lost when you exit the game, even after manually saving the profile. To fix this, follow the instructions:
Select Multiplayer - Split Screen - Press Start on a second controller / or press Enter on the keyboard
P1: Select any team & driver
P2: Select any team & driver - Any Race Settings - Any track.
Once on track P1 pause and select Options - Driving Controls and change Control Profile to another option and then back again. Exit back out of the Pause menu.
P2 pause and select Options - Driving Controls and change Control Profile to another option and then back again. Back out to Pause Options, select Quit To Main Menu - Yes.
You should now be able to save again.

The bad news is that the save problem can appear again randomly again, later on, like before. To be sure, just do this procedure I mention every-time before you exit the game. Or at least when you finish playing a big important race, and you want to make sure is save.
Also, I recommend you backup your userdata folders every-time you exit the game. Is on C:\Users\USERNAME\AppData\Local\FLT and C:\Users\USERNAME\Documents\My Games\FormulaOne2012
And disable steam cloud sync, to avoid data corruption.
